Here are 4 specific messaging transformations to implement immediately. These changes matter because they shift the narrative from "features we built" to "outcomes the user desires."
Before: "Maximize Your Website Revenue with Effective CPM Network"
After: "Instantly Boost Your Ad Revenue by 30%—Without Slowing Down Your Site."
Why it works: The "After" version provides a specific numerical anchor (30%), promises speed, and directly addresses a massive publisher pain point (site speed degradation from ad tags).
Before: "We offer high eCPMs, fast payouts, and the best ad formats for publishers and advertisers globally."
After: "Join 5,000+ premium publishers earning industry-leading eCPMs. Get paid on time, every time, with Net-15 terms and zero hidden fees."
Why it works: It introduces social proof (5,000+ publishers), clarifies the exact payout timeline (Net-15), and removes the confusing mention of "advertisers" to keep the focus sharp.
Before: "Sign Up Now"
After: "Start Monetizing Today" (with microcopy below: Setup takes under 5 minutes)
Why it works: "Start Monetizing Today" focuses on the financial benefit the user wants, while the microcopy completely eliminates the fear of a long, tedious technical integration.
